The doing is often more important than the outcome.” Petroleum & Gas Engineering Department, UET, Lahore, believes in the inevitable role of a fortified academia-industry collaboration for sustained excellence. With a view to further bolster existing cooperation across various domains, UET, Lahore and Schlumberger Seaco Inc. (Pakistan Branch) sign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) on Wednesday, August 4, 2021. Prof. Dr. Syed Mansoor Sarwar, Vice-Chancellor, UET, Lahore, and Mr. Zaurayze Tarique, Managing Director, Schlumberger (Pakistan & Yemen) signed the document on behalf of their respective organizations. The MoU signing ceremony was held at Vice-Chancellor’s Office, UET, Lahore, and was attended by senior faculty members from the University, including Prof. Dr. Muhammad Khurram Zahoor, Chairman, Petroleum & Gas Engineering Department, UET, Lahore, Prof. Dr. Muhammad Zubair Abu-Bakar, Dean, Faculty of Earth Sciences & Engineering, Prof. Dr. -Ing. Naveed Ramzan, Dean, Faculty of Chemical, Metallurgical & Polymer Engineering, Prof. Dr. Saima Yasin, Chairperson, Chemical Engineering Department, UET, Lahore and Dr. Muhammad Shafiq, Director UA&EL. The signed MoU is expected to serve as an instrument for better streamlining of Schlumberger’s student-centered activities at UET, Lahore, such as recruitment drives, internship opportunities, technical sessions and instructional visits to Schlumberger facilities, for which the department has always been and will continue to be the focal point in future as well.
